Nicasio Amazingly Back on the Mound
Despite a disappointing season for the Colorado Rockies in 2011, the club did have two pitchers not yet 25-year-olds with Adjusted-ERAs (ERA+) of 126 and 108. One was Jhoulys Chacin, 23, who racked up 194 innings and figures to be a pillar in the Rockies rotation for years. The other was Juan Nicasio, 24, who had a 2.22 ERA in nine starts at Double-A before making his MLB debut with the Rockies.
Rox invite Moyer to Spring Training
The Colorado Rockies have announced that the club has come to an agreement with Jamie Moyer on a minor league contract with an invitation to Spring Training, pending a physical. Moyer is 49 years old and coming off Tommy John reconstructive elbow surgery, but he should be ready for the start of camp.

Rockies deal Seth Smith to the A's
The Colorado Rockies have traded outfielder Seth Smith to the Oakland Athletics. The writing was seemingly on the wall for Smith to be moved once the club brought in Michael Cuddyer. The move comes shortly after the Rockies agreed with Smith on a $2.4 million salary for 2012.
